Florida-Grown Christmas Trees to Arrive at Capitol on Tuesday
Agriculture Commissioner Adam Putnam will present Florida-grown Christmas trees for the entrances to the Capitol offices of Gov. Rick Scott, Attorney General Pam Bondi and Chief Financial Officer Jeff Atwater on Tuesday.
“Each year, Florida's 100 tree-farms harvest approximately 14,000 trees, which earns the state more than $2 million in cash receipts,” a release from Putnam’s office stated.
The trees were grown by Franco and Sigrid Camacho of the Bavarian Christmas Tree Farm in Tallahassee.
